Caring for your lawn in Hoolehua, HI, involves knowing your soil type, understanding the local climate, and timing your lawn maintenance routines effectively. With a tropical climate in Hoolehua, it's essential to know the best practices for lawn care, such as mowing, fertilizing, seeding, watering, aerating, and dethatching. The best time of year to carry out these tasks is typically during the wet seasons when rain is abundant and temperatures are moderate.

Mowing is a crucial part of lawn care and should be done weekly during the growing season to maintain a healthy height of about 3-4 inches. This height helps protect the soil from excessive heat and retains moisture. It's crucial to keep the blades of your mower sharp, as dull blades can tear the grass and cause brown patches.

Fertilization should be done about 1-2 times a year, preferably during the early spring and fall. Use a slow-release fertilizer that is rich in nitrogen. For Hoolehua's typical clay or loamy soil, look for fertilizers that are high in phosphorus to promote strong root growth.

Seeding your lawn, especially in neighborhoods like Kualapuu and Maunaloa, can be beneficial in maintaining its lushness. The best time to seed is during the rainy season when the soil is moist and the seeds can germinate easily.

Aerating and dethatching are also crucial for a healthy lawn. Aerating helps oxygen, water, and nutrients reach the roots, while dethatching removes the layer of dead grass and moss that can suffocate your lawn. In Hoolehua, it's best to aerate and dethatch your lawn during the cooler months to avoid stressing the grass.

Lastly, watering is vital, especially during dry spells. However, keep in mind any local water restrictions. Deep watering is recommended, as this encourages the roots to grow deeper and makes the lawn more drought-resistant.
